Central Garden & Pet (CENT) Tops Q2 EPS by 6c; Raises Outlook

May 4, 2016 5:37 PM

Central Garden & Pet (NASDAQ: CENT) reported Q2 EPS of $0.65, $0.06 better than the analyst estimate of $0.59. Revenue for the quarter came in at $541.2 million versus the consensus estimate of $528.25 million.

GUIDANCE:

Central Garden & Pet raises FY2016 EPS to at least $1.10, versus the consensus of $1.08.

"We are very pleased to have achieved the highest quarterly revenues in the Company's history and its highest quarterly earnings per share in ten years," said John Ranelli, President & CEO of Central Garden & Pet. “These results reflect our success in increasing revenues, reducing costs, and positioning our portfolio of businesses for success. These efforts are on-going, and the Company remains committed to growing in the years ahead by continuing to execute on the strategy and plan we have been following over the course of the last few years." Ranelli continued, "With our leverage ratio down to 3.1x at the end of the quarter vs. 4.5x a year ago, Central is well-positioned to utilize its strong cash flow and balance sheet to fund future growth both organically and through acquisitions."
